Output 984d0580ae6689b23384f17fd42bf88e234fcd26f3d015713439d11eee402026:1

value
2765334
script pubkey
OP_0 OP_PUSHBYTES_20 95f79e58be0923136eeb62a5b0c55bee074c2856
address
ltc1qjhmeuk97py33xmhtv2jmp32macr5c2zkhfy4aa
transaction
984d0580ae6689b23384f17fd42bf88e234fcd26f3d015713439d11eee402026
spent
true